MaxMyPoint has become one of our favorite tools for finding hotel award availability, and it’s now even more useful thanks to several new search upgrades.

The popular platform for searching hotel award availability has rolled out several new enhancements, headlined by support for Bilt’s Home Away From Home (HAFH). The update also includes a handful of other improvements aimed to making searching for hotels and comparing your options a little easier.

Here’s a look at what’s new.

Bilt Home Away From Home Joins MaxMyPoint

The biggest addition in MaxMyPoint‘s latest update is Bilt’s Home Away From Home (HAFH) platform.

If you’re not familiar with it, HAFH is Bilt’s version of premium hotel booking programs like American Express Fine Hotels + Resorts (FHR), The Hotel Collection, or The Edit by Chase Travel.

Eligible stays booked through the Bilt Travel Portal can include perks like complimentary breakfast, room upgrades (when available), late checkout, and property credits.

With this update, MaxMyPoint now identifies hotels that are part of Bilt’s Home Away From Home (HAFH) Collection directly in its search results. That means Bilt cardholders and Bilt Rewards members can quickly spot eligible properties and see where they may be able to stack HAFH benefits with hotel elite status perks, promotions, or even award stays.

It’s also one less website to check. Instead of searching MaxMyPoint for award availability and then opening Bilt Travel to see whether a hotel is part of Bilt’s HAFH, you can now see that information in one place while comparing your options.

New Hotel Rate Timeline Makes It Easier To Find Cheaper Dates

Another useful MaxMyPoint addition is a new Nightly Rate Timeline on each hotel page. It shows how nightly rates have trended over time, making it easy to see whether prices have been moving up or down based on historical data.

If a property participates in both Amex’s FHR and Bilt’s HAFH platforms, you can now compare pricing between the 2 programs across different months to see which offers the better deal.

Hot Tip:

Hotel rates can vary significantly throughout the year. Take a quick look at the Nightly Rate Timeline before booking to see if it can help you find lower-priced dates.

More Hotel Details Before You Book

MaxMyPoint is also expanding the information available on individual hotel pages. You can now see additional details like a property’s opening and renovation year, whether it offers free parking, and its pet policy.

It’s helpful information to have before booking, especially if you’re comparing multiple hotels. These new features are currently rolling out in beta, and MaxMyPoint says user feedback will help determine future improvements to the platform.

Final Thoughts

MaxMyPoint keeps adding useful features that make planning a hotel stay a little easier, and the addition of Bilt’s Home Away From Home (HAFH) Collection is especially useful for Bilt Rewards members.

HAFH may be the biggest addition, but it’s not the only new feature. If you already use MaxMyPoint to search for hotel award availability, you now have a few more tools and a little more information to help you compare your options.
